Websites hosted on 172.67.191.130 IP address

1 websites

IP address 172.67.191.130 is registered for United States. The server carries IP 172.67.191.130 located at latitude 37.7757 and longitude -122.395, time zone is GMT -8. Server location in California, San Francisco, United States, zipcode 94107.

1.Seewide.com

seewide.com Rank:1,457,635 Worth:$210

SeeWide致力打造全港玩樂攻略指南,聚集全港探險家,一同搜羅及分享精彩的玩樂、消閒、飲食、生活等情報,務求讓大家能看多一點、闊一點!這也正是SeeWide名字的由來!

Let's share 💋💋💋